1. Matera: Sassi Tour with Entry to Rock Houses and Churches

Historic Center and Sassi TourIt consists of a walking tour from the main square of the historic centre, Piazza Vittorio Veneto (starting point, arch-shaped fountain reference), with a panoramic view of the Sasso Barisano.Continue through the historic center until you reach Piazza Duomo where it will be possible to view the Cathedral from the outside and then enter the Sasso Caveoso. From here there will be a visit to the furnished house of peasant civilization, a frescoed rock church, a visit to the barbaric cemetery and the various neighborhoods.Everything will be explained by an authorized guide, which will allow you to understand the history of the city.The tour will end in Piazza Giovanni Pascoli in the historic center, close to the Sasso Caveoso.

3. Brindisi: walking tour of the Old Town with Local Guide

The tour starts from Piazza Vittorio Emanuele, exactly where the most famous Roman road, the Via Appia, ended. You will reach the stairways and admire the imposing Roman Columns. From here you will continue to the historic center visiting the beautiful Piazza Duomo and the Cathedral. You go inside the Renaissance Palazzo Granafei Nervegna and you will be amazed at the sight the enormous Roman capital. You will pass under the Teatro Verdi to admire the remains of a real Roman block. The tour will end admiring the splendid Romanesque church of S. Giovanni al Sepolcro, one of the most faithful copies of the Holy Sepulcher in Jerusalem (from outside)

4. Matera: 007 "No Time to Die" Film Sites Walking Tour

The city of Matera has become an important filming location since the 50’s. Most of the films produced here share different biblical topics due to the fascinating landscapes of the ancient city which are very similar to locations you can find in Holy Land. Though in 2019, another "action" side of Matera was revealed by the new 007 “No Time To Die” film shooting. Step behind the scenes of the greatest spy film of all time while exploring the streets and history of Matera. Explore both the Sasso Caveoso and the Sasso Barisano and visit Piazza Vittorio Veneto, Piazza San Giovanni, via Madonna delle Virtù, admiring the view from the Civita area and Piazza Duomo.
